Change subject: Workaround JSONTest failure in Firefox 17
......................................................................


Patch Set 2:

Yeah, this is the best workaround I have at the moment. The infuriating thing is the test failure was related to the order of execution of test methods in JSONTest, so each time I tried to remove one that I thought was unrelated, it risked shuffling the method order around and causing the failure to go away.

I've spent the last five or so hours now making tiny incremental reductions to JSONTest trying to minimize the test case. Still a ways to go though... (at least I'm down to just one test method now)
